Board Examination Review, September 6-9, 2000
The Harvard Medical School Dermatopathology Residency Training Program will present a 3 -day postgraduate course in dermatopathology with a 1-day symposium on cutaneous infections under the direction of Lyn M. Duncan, MD, to be held at the Fairmont Copley Plaza Hotel, Boston, Mass. Faculty will include Christopher D. M. Fletcher, MD, Thomas J. Flotte, MD, Marshall Kadin, MD, Eugene L. Mark, MD, Phillip H. McKee, MD, Martin C. Mihm Jr, MD, and Samuel L. Moschella, MD.
Participants will review practical dermatopathology with attention to board certification and will learn to assess problems that arise in dermatopathology practice. The course is aimed at practicing pathologists and dermatologists as well as residents and fellows preparing for board certification examinations. On Friday a symposium on cutaneous infections will be presented. On Saturday morning there will be a board examination review session.
